首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Spring 基础知识面试

如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...SpringMvc函数返回是什么? 答:返回可以有很多类型,有String, ModelAndView,当一般用String比较好。 ModelAndView把视图和数据都合并一起 41....3)Struts采用栈存储请求和响应数据,通过OGNL存取数据,springmvc通过参数解析器是request请求内容解析,并给方法形参赋值,数据和视图封装成ModelAndView对象,最后又将

87510
您找到你想要的搜索结果了吗?
是的
没有找到

面试必备:Spring 面试问题 TOP 50

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。为了定义 bean,Spring 基于 XML 配置元数据在或 中提供了元素使用。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: 5、H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...6、数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 7、数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...8、数据验证: 验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

88410

Spring 面试问题 TOP 50

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ter:请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。如字符串转换成格式化数字或格式化日期等。...数据验证:验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

66420

Spring 面试问题 TOP 50

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...数据验证: 验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

67620

Spring 面试问题 TOP 50

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。为了定义 bean,Spring 基于 XML 配置元数据在或 中提供了元素使用。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...数据验证: 验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

75930

Spring 面试问题 TOP 50

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。为了定义 bean,Spring 基于 XML 配置元数据在 或 中提供了 元素使用。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...数据验证: 验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

70020

近 3 年常考 Spring 面试题及答案

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ter:请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。如字符串转换成格式化数字或格式化日期等。...数据验证:验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

80720

Spring 面试问题 TOP 50

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。为了定义 bean,Spring 基于 XML 配置元数据在 或 中提供了 元素使用。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...数据验证: 验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

59610

49个Spring经典面试题总结,附带答案,赶紧收藏

如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...@ResponseBody - 用于发送 Object 作为响应,通常用于发送 XML 或 JSON 数据作为响应。 @PathVariable - 用于动态 URI 映射到处理程序方法参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ter:请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。如字符串转换成格式化数字或格式化日期等。...数据验证:验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

51140

Java面试中常问Spring方面问题

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...数据验证: 验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

96020

Java面试中常问Spring方面问题(涵盖七大方向共55道题,含答案)

只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ter: 请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如String转换成Integer、Double等。 数据根式化:对请求消息进行数据格式化。 如字符串转换成格式化数字或格式化日期等。...数据验证: 验证数据有效性(长度、格式等),验证结果存储到BindingResult或Error

86930

细数Spring那些最常见面试问题

如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...@ResponseBody - 用于发送 Object 作为响应,通常用于发送 XML 或 JSON 数据作为响应。 @PathVariable - 用于动态 URI 映射到处理程序方法参数。...在填充Handler入参过程根据配置,Spring 帮你做一些额外工作: HttpMessageConveter:请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...数据转换:对请求消息进行数据转换。如`String`转换成`Integer`、`Double`等。 数据根式化:对请求消息进行数据格式化。如字符串转换成格式化数字或格式化日期等。...数据验证:验证数据有效性(长度、格式等),验证结果存储到`BindingResult`或`Error`

67040

数据编制架构】Data Fabric 架构:优点和缺点

本文探讨这些问题。 Data Fabric架构三种模式 广义上讲,似乎至少存在三种流行数据编织架构概念。...第一种方法数据编织视为一种严格分散架构,即一种获取原本分布数据方法,而无需先将其整合到中央存储库,例如数据湖或数据仓库。在最平淡情况下,这样方案不再强调集中访问在数据架构作用。...在最激进情况下,它完全拒绝集中访问需要。 相比之下,第二种更具包容性数据编织这些集中式存储库视为分布式数据架构非特权参与者:湖或仓库数据像其他来源一样通过数据编织暴露出来以供访问。...这对于针对分散资源数据运行常见查询非常有用——无论是在云中还是在本地。另一个 DV 用例是作为频繁刷新报告支持技术。...潜在有价值来源不仅包括应用程序、服务和数据库,还包括文件数据CSV、电子表格、PDF,甚至是通过 SMB 和 NFS 网络共享公开 PowerPoint 文件,或持久存储到对象存储层(如 Amazon

1K10

Data Fabric 2024:现代数据集成组件指南

用户可以使用数据编织来简化多云数据环境数据治理和管理。 3.公司如何数据编织受益? 自动化数据治理:它自动公司策略应用于数据并提供可信数据。...在这种情况下,数据编织可以将其数据集成到现有架构。 6.5数据可扩展性 数据编织解决方案可以让组织扩展其数据基础设施以满足以下需求: 不断增长数据量 多样化数据类型和格式。...例如,组织可以客户数据存储在多个数据库和文件系统数据编织可以所有这些数据汇集在一起并用于分析。...元数据可以帮助理解数据模式、组合来自不同来源数据并实时分析流数据。 8.数据编织数据虚拟化、数据联邦 数据编织数据虚拟化和数据联邦有时会被混淆。在本节,我们解释这些术语。...连接器负责将来自不同来源数据换为通用格式,并每次都以相同方式显示。 8.3.2数据虚拟化与数据联邦 相比之下,虚拟化创建了一个位于底层数据源之上虚拟层,并提供统一且一致数据视图。

11510

Spring常见面试题

基于 xml 配置 bean 所需依赖项和服务在 XML 格式配置文件中指定。这些配置文件通常包含许多 bean 定义和特定于应用程序配置选项。它们通常以 bean 标签开头。...只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。...byName - 它根据 bean 名称注入对象依赖项。它匹配并装配其属性与 XML 文件由相同名称定义 bean。 byType - 它根据类型注入对象依赖项。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...@ResponseBody - 用于发送 Object 作为响应,通常用于发送 XML 或 JSON 数据作为响应。 @PathVariable - 用于动态 URI 映射到处理程序方法参数

49410

Spring、springboot面试宝典100问

如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。构造函数- 它通过调用构造函数来注 入依赖项。它有大量参数。...在填充 Handler 入参过程根据配置,Spring 帮你做一些额外工作:· HttpMessageConveter:请求消息(如 Json、 xml 等数据)转换成一个对象,将对象转换为指定响应信息...· 数据 换:对请求消息进行数据转换。如 String 转换成 Integer、Double 等。 · 数据根式化:对请求消息进行数据格式化。如字符串转换成格式化数字或格式化日期等。...该容器 XML 文件读取配置元数据并用它去创建一个完全配置系统或应用。...l Spring 容器 XML 文件读取 bean 定义,并实例化 bean。 l Spring 根据 bean 定义填充所有的属性。

22410

全网最全Spring系列面试题129道(附答案解析)

如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。构造函数- 它通过调用构造函数来注入依赖项。它有大量参数。...在填充 Handler 入参过程根据配置,Spring 帮你做一些额外工作: · HttpMessageConveter:请求消息(如 Json、xml 等数据)转换成一个对象,将对象转换为指定响应信息...· 数据转换:对请求消息进行数据转换。如 String 转换成 Integer、Double 等。 · 数据根式化:对请求消息进行数据格式化。如字符串转换成格式化数字或格式化日期等。...· 数据验证:验证数据有效性(长度、格式等),验证结果存储到BindingResult 或 Error 。 ...该容器 XML 文件读取配置元数据并用它去创建一个完全配置系统或应用。

84910

Spring常见面试题

基于 xml 配置 bean 所需依赖项和服务在 XML 格式配置文件中指定。这些配置文件通常包含许多 bean 定义和特定于应用程序配置选项。它们通常以 bean 标签开头。...只有 bean 用作另一个 bean 属性时,才能将 bean 声明为内部 bean。...byName - 它根据 bean 名称注入对象依赖项。它匹配并装配其属性与 XML 文件由相同名称定义 bean。 byType - 它根据类型注入对象依赖项。...如果属性类型与 XML 文件一个 bean 名称匹配,则匹配并装配属性。 构造函数 - 它通过调用构造函数来注入依赖项。它有大量参数。...@ResponseBody - 用于发送 Object 作为响应,通常用于发送 XML 或 JSON 数据作为响应。 @PathVariable - 用于动态 URI 映射到处理程序方法参数

48750

2022 最新 Spring 面试题(一)

脏读 :表示一个事务能够读取另一个事务还未提交数据。比如,某个事务尝试插入记录 A,此时该事务还未提交,然后另一个事务尝试读取到了记录 A。 不可重复读 :是指在一个事务内,多次读同一数据。...如果属 性类型与 XML 文件一个 bean 名称匹配 ,则匹配并装配属性 。 构造函数 - 它通过调用构造函数来注入依赖项 。它有大量参数 。...在填充 Handler 入参过程根据配置, Spring 帮你做一些额外工作: · HttpMessageConveter :请求消息(如 Json、xml 等数据)转换 成一个对象...· 数据转换 :对请求消息进行数据转换。如 String 转换成 Integer、 Double 等。 · 数据根式化 :对请求消息进行数据格式化。如字符串转换成格式化数字 或格式化日期等。...· 数据验证 :验证数据有效性(长度、格式等),验证结果存储到 BindingResult 或 Error

6810
领券